Administrative Assistant applicants have rated the interview process at JCPenney with 1.5 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 50% positive. To compare, the company-average is 72.6%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Administrative Assistant roles take an average of 30 days to get hired, when considering 2 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at JCPenney overall takes an average of 13 days.
Common stages of the interview process at JCPenney as a Administrative Assistant according to 2 Glassdoor interviews include:
Phone interview: 50%
One on one interview: 50%

Applied online in December 2013. Received an email from recruiter three weeks later asking to schedule a phone screen. Phone screen went great. Told I would be one of the two possibly three candidates that would move to the next stage which was an in-person interview with Hiring Manager. Met with Hiring Manager who was the Market Leader. Easy interview. More conversational than question and answer.
